Fixes #10527
Solution
I added a condition if
opts.TitleProvidedandopts.BodyProvidedthen add the title and body.I also noticed that using this command:
gh pr create --assignee @me --fill --title "test" --body "ticket number" --webgive the expected behaviour but when omitting the --assignee option it does not.
